A soil examination will certainly determine the level of dirt acidity, which is utilized to produce a recommended quantity of lime for your lawn. Lime is ideal used in the loss and early winter season seasons, and when done correctly will not require to be applied every year. See Rutgers Cooperative Extension (RCE) publication Dirt Checking for Home Lawns and Gardens (FS797), and for more details about obtaining your soil examined.

Shade and growth rate of the yard offer as an overview in figuring out the demand for nitrogen plant food. Slow-moving development and light-green shade ought to be expected at different times of the year for yards with a low-maintenance purpose. Serious thinning of the grass and exposure of dirt is a likely symptom of nutrient shortage under a low-maintenance program.




Various fertilizer items are commercially readily available and are composed of two fundamental kinds of N: water soluble and water insoluble. Water insoluble nitrogen (VICTORY) is likewise understood as slowly offered or slow-moving release and is typically the most safe and easier form Read Full Report to utilize for the majority of residential or commercial property owners, albeit a lot more expensive.




Select a fertilizer quality (N-P2O5-K2O) based on the results of a soil examination. See Feeding the Home Lawn (FS633) for even more info. Enhancement of organic matter to boost dirt is best done before developing a lawn considering that it is an extremely challenging and slow-moving procedure to integrate natural materials into dirt after lawn has covered the soil.


Continuous mowing at 2 inches or lower has a tendency to damage the grass and increase insect and other stress and anxiety problems (Lawn Care). Frequency of mowing is finest established by the price of growth of the lawn. As an overview, trim as often as essential to remove no greater than of the fallen leave elevation in a solitary mowing

A plain blade shreds the lawn leaves, weakens the lawn, and transforms the fallen leave tips brownish, presenting an unsightly look to the lawn. Plain mower blades might additionally raise the severity of foliar turfgrass conditions. Mowing should stop in the loss when grass development has essentially discontinued because of chilly climate.


Recuperation from this condition needs water and time for brand-new fallen leaves to be re-formed and recover turf cover. Watering ought to dampen the soil to a depth of 6 inches, which should be enough water for about 1 week on "much heavier" finer-textured soils and 2 to 3 days on sandy soilsapplying much less water than this will certainly result in the demand for more frequent watering.




Late night with very early morning is useful link one of the most efficient and efficient amount of time for watering. See Ideal Administration Practices for Watering Lawns (FS555) to find out more. Dethatching energetic thick yards that have accumulated a thick layer of natural product (thatch, being composed primarily of origins and rhizomes) on the dirt surface and listed below the environment-friendly fallen leaves can improve the stress and anxiety resistance of the yard.


As soon as the yard has greater than a -inch deep thatch layer, it would profit from dethatching in the loss. Mechanical gadgets (dethatching equipments) are available for purchase or leasing. These devices must have a vertical blade rigidly repaired on a rotating shaft and the capacity to readjust the blade to penetrate totally through the thatch layer and right into the soil.
